Maintenance

Wood stoves can provide a cozy, warm feel to your living space. They are costly to purchase and require regular maintenance to function smoothly. The good part is that there are less expensive models of these stoves which can still provide you with a great heat output. However, you should think about whether a cheap wood burner is the best option for your needs prior to buying one.

Before you start using your cheap wood burning stove, make sure it is properly installed and that the chimney has been swept. This is crucial because it can help stop fires and other damages to your house. It is recommended to use a Hetas registered sweep who also undertakes servicing and repairs.

It is also possible to replace the bars for retaining logs and the door for handling logs if they are damaged or worn. Verify that the firebricks in good condition. Replace them immediately if they are cracked.

Additionally, you should regularly clean the ash tray as well as the stove glass using a specific cleaning product. This will stop the build-up of carbon monoxide and soot in the air. It is also essential to burn wood that has been seasoned. This will allow you to burn more efficiently and produce less ash.

vobor-wood-burning-stove-stainless-steel-folding-wood-burning-stove-portable-mini-cooker-for-travel-hiking-picnic-outdoor-camping-1831.jpgAlways keep an extinguisher for fire in the house and make sure that all family members are aware of how to use it. You should never leave the stove unattended, or attempt to cook on it. Also, you should clean the chimney frequently to prevent blockages and maintain an air flow. Also, it is essential to ensure that the stove is cool down before you clean it. If you follow these easy guidelines, your wood stove should last for many years to come.
